Cheap Flights from Burlington (BTV) to Johannesburg (HLA)

Popular airlines from Burlington Intl. Airport (BTV) to Lanseria Intl. Airport (HLA)

Alternative airports near Johannesburg

Prices were available within the past 7 days. Prices and availability are subject to change.

Travel information

Origin airport
Burlington Intl.
Destination airport
Lanseria
Distance
7976 mi

Book with confidence

Explore a world of travel with Expedia

*Available to One Key members.